Ranking of Pennsylvania Counties By Unemployment Rate in June 2013

Updated on February 11, 2025.

According to data from the US BLS, for June 2013, among all Pennsylvania counties, Philadelphia had the highest unemployment rate (10.2%), followed by Forest (9.7%), and Clinton (9.5%).
